Abstract

Multioscillator beam-combining optics having prisms for processing both clockwise and anticlockwise elliptically polarized beams having both helicities transmitted through a partly transmissive corner mirror. The optical structure uses a thin-film polarizer with a waveplate which is not necessarily a quarter wave plate. Further, the waveplate thickness is determined so that one component of elliptically polarized light is converted into a linearly polarized beam. A thin film polarizer then blocks the linearly polarized beam. The waveplate principal crystal axes form a nominally forty five degree angle with the s and p polarization axes. Techniques are used to keep extraneous birefringence of the beams to a minimum.
